Qualify Fha Loans FHA Refinance and Loan Fact #9 Pre-qualify for an FHA Home Loan. To pre-qualify for an FHA loan, you should be able to demonstrate employability, job stability and reliability.

FHA Credit Requirements for 2019 fha loan applicants must have a minimum FICO score of 580 to qualify for the low down payment advantage which is currently at 3.5%. If your credit score is below 580, the down payment requirement is 10%. You can see why it’s important that your credit history is in good standing.
